Frequently Asked Questions about Short-term Woodfield Estates Apartments

What is the Cheapest Short-term apartment in Woodfield Estates?

Currently the most affordable Short-term Apartment in Woodfield Estates is at Mulberry Place listed at $1,340.

How much is the average rent for a Short-term Woodfield Estates Apartment?

The average rent for a Short-term Apartment in Woodfield Estates is $1,877.

What is the largest Short-term Woodfield Estates Apartment for rent?

Today's Short-term apartment with the most square footage in Woodfield Estates is a 1,422 square feet unit starting from $2,400 at Copper Leaf Residences Building A.

What is the average size for Woodfield Estates Short-term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Short-term rental in Woodfield Estates is currently at 729 sq ft.
